AI-Driven Anonymization: Protecting Personal Data Privacy While Leveraging Machine Learning
Feb. 28, 2024, 5:42 a.m. | Le Yang, Miao Tian, Duan Xin, Qishuo Cheng, Jiajian Zheng
cs.LG updates on arXiv.org arxiv.org
Abstract: The development of artificial intelligence has significantly transformed people's lives. However, it has also posed a significant threat to privacy and security, with numerous instances of personal information being exposed online and reports of criminal attacks and theft. Consequently, the need to achieve intelligent protection of personal information through machine learning algorithms has become a paramount concern. Artificial intelligence leverages advanced algorithms and technologies to effectively encrypt and anonymize personal data, enabling valuable data analysis …
